Faro (FAO) to Zurich (ZRH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Faro Airport (FAO) in Faro, Portugal to Zurich Airport (ZRH) in Zurich, Switzerland is 1,782 kilometers (1,107 miles / 962 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ying northeast at a heading of 44°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Portugal with Switzerland.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 07:09 in Faro, it's 08:09 in Zurich.

There is a significant elevation difference of 1,392 feet between the two airports. Zurich Airport sits higher than Faro Airport.

The return flight from Zurich (ZRH) to Faro (FAO) follows a heading of 235° (south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
